oracle中用update 批量修改某列数值,求代码!
发布网友
发布时间:2022-05-02 22:46
我来回答
共2个回答
热心网友
时间:2022-04-12 00:03
用substr 把列中 停止 后面的字符留下在更新给列
update TableName set Column = substr(Column,length('停止')+1,length(Column) - length('停止')) where Column like '停止%';
或者 substr(Column,5,length(Column) - 5)
热心网友
时间:2022-04-12 01:21
update TableName set Column = Replace(Column,'停止','') where Column like '停止%'
TableName是你的表名
Column是你的列名追问这个不行的,字段下的内容没有任何改变。
oracle中用update 批量修改某列数值,求代码!
update TableName set Column = substr(Column,length('停止')+1,length(Column) - length('停止')) where Column like '停止%';或者 substr(Column,5,length(Column) - 5)
oracle数据库如何用update批量更新某列数据中的字段
跟Sql Server类似。可以使用编程,或者使用PL/SQL连接Oracle数据库,登陆连接后,使用以下Sql:update table set id='TT'where a='XX';以上语句,就是将表table中列a='XX'的所有id列改为“TT”。条件可以添加多个,更新的字段也可以添加多个,比如:update table set id1='TT',id2='CC'where a...
oracle数据库怎么批量修改数据?
1、使用以下代码即可同时更新一个表中几个字段的值:updateASET(C1,C2,C3,C4)=(SELECTC1,C2,C3,C4FROMBWHEREID=A.ID)Oracle数据库最新版本为OracleDatabase12c。2、update表名set(字段1,字段2,字段3,...)=(select数值1,数值2,数值3,...)where条件多个字段可以使用逗号隔开,每一个...
在ORACLE 中用update语句批量修改
一种办法是如果待修改的ID不多的话直接改WHERE ID IN(1,2,3,4,5...)呀;如果ID多的话,用存储过程写个循环,批量执行
Oracle中update能不能批量插入一列数据
oracle中update可以批量修改一列数据,而不是插入一列数据。如,目前test表中有两列数据。现在要为表增加一个age字段,可用如下语句:alter table test add age int;此时表结构如下:现在要为age赋值为20,则可用update语句,如下:update test set age=20;commit;修改后结果:...
关于oracle数据库用update批量更新数据问题
UPDATE TAB1 SET TAB1.A = (SELECT TAB2.B FROM TAB2 WHERE TAB1.A = TAB2.A) WHERE TAB1.A IN (SELECT TAB2.A FROM TAB2);
oracle中update怎样同时更新一个表中几个字段的值
使用以下代码即可同时更新一个表中几个字段的值:1.update A 2.SET (C1,C2,C3,C4)=(SELECT C1,C2,C3,C4 FROM B WHERE ID=A.ID)一、Oracle数据库最新版本为Oracle Database 12c。Oracle数据库12c 引入了一个新的多承租方架构,使用该架构可轻松部署和管理数据库云。此外,一些创新特性可最大...
请教一个关于oracle数据库某个字段批量update的问题!
按你的要求,下面的语句可以解决,没有必要用循环语句。update 表 set 列=9+列-trunc(列,0)where 列>10;update 表 set 列=1+列-trunc(列,0)where 列<1;
oracle如何批量修改字段中的数据
需要用updata语句来批量修改。如图,test表中有如下数据:现在要将id小于3的name改成“孙七”,可用如下语句:update test set name='孙七' where id<3;commit;执行后结果为:
oracle update set 多个字段
Oracle的UPDATE语句可以同时更新多个字段,当你需要在一个查询中处理多个字段时,可以使用子查询和 EXISTS 条件来实现。下面是一个示例,展示了如何在一个复杂的嵌套查询中更新 M_CHARGEPOLE_REAL 表中的数据:sql UPDATE M_CHARGEPOLE_REAL t SET field1 = 新的值1, field2 = 新的值2, ...WHERE...